Lathe Working Mount Varieties Described
Understanding the types of machine tool clamp is critical for achieving optimal machining output. Common styles include round holders, which basic uses; hex holders, offering increased clamping and rigidity; and angled holders, allowing for angling a cutting point. Furthermore, you will encounter specialized holders created for particular operations, such as creating channels or producing threads. Choosing some appropriate holder directly impacts workpiece precision and tool duration.
